A decent base is one of those things that people don't always think about until something goes wrong. Concrete slabs, paving stones or timber frames are common options for bases, and each of these has its place depending on the ground conditions. Shed installers who work around Winscombe will make sure to check drainage & soil levels first so that the shed doesn't start leaning after the first rough winter.

Weatherproofing deserves a bit of attention as well. A shed might look sturdy enough on day one, but wind & rain can slowly creep in if the timber isn't sealed properly. Many homeowners in the Winscombe area will ask installers to apply wood treatment, roofing felt, and sealants during the installation, so that the shed will stay dry, protect tools, and hold up well through the damp British weather.

Placement is more important than most people appreciate. A shed that is tucked too close to a fence can become awkward to maintain, and poor levels of sunlight can encourage damp or moss on the roof. Installers working in and around Winscombe will usually help you to pick a sensible position that balances access, drainage & how the structure fits into the overall garden layout.
